    Background and Purposes : Atopic dermatitis (AD) is a chronic inflammatory skin disease characterized by immune dysregulation and barrier dysfunction. Orientin, a flavonoid compound, has shown potential anti-inflammatory properties. This study investigates the effects of orientin on inflammatory responses in keratinocytes and its therapeutic potential in an AD-like animal model.
    Materials and methods : HaCaT cells, a human keratinocyte line, were treated with varying concentrations of orientin to assess its effects on cell viability, cytokine production, and skin barrier function. RT-PCR and Western blot analyses were conducted to evaluate the expression of involucrin (INV) and filaggrin (FLG), as well as the activation of MAPK signaling pathways. In vivo, an AD-like mouse model was induced using dinitrochlorobenzene (DNCB), and the effects of orientin on AD symptoms, serum IgE levels, skin thickness, and T cell infiltration were examined.
    Results and conclusions : Orientin treatment did not significantly affect INV expression but showed a trend towards increasing FLG expression at concentrations of 12.5 and 25 μM. In HaCaT cells, orientin significantly inhibited ERK phosphorylation without affecting JNK and p38 MAPK activation. In the AD-like animal model, orientin reduced AD symptoms, decreased serum IgE levels, and attenuated inflammatory cell infiltration in skin lesions. Orientin exhibits anti-inflammatory effects by modulating skin barrier function and MAPK signaling pathways in keratinocytes, and it alleviates symptoms in an AD-like animal model. These findings suggest that orientin may be a promising candidate for the treatment of AD.
